Take for instance just yesterday 2 stocks come to mind DIGL, and IOM. DIGL was an $11 stock on Thursday at the close. Earnings come out and wham the stock trades in the range of 3 3/4 - 4 15/16 a drop of over 6 pts or greater then 50%. What does CS First Boston do on Friday downgrades the stock from "Strong Buy to Hold". Another stock IOM on Thursday the stock is trading in the high 12's. Earning come out after the close and on Friday the stock trades in the range of 8 3/4 - 9 a drop of 25%. Guess what Needham downgrades the stock on Friday from Buy to Hold.
